Step 1
First,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×13-inch baking pan.
Step 2
Then, melt butter in a saucepan, then add sugar, and stir well.
Beat eggs and vanilla in a separate bowl, then add to the saucepan and stir.
Step 3
After that, sift the flour, cocoa powder, and salt into the saucepan and stir until combined, then fold in chopped walnuts (optional), and pour the batter into the greased baking pan and spread evenly.
Step 4
Next, bake for about 25 to 30 minutes (until a toothpick comes out with a few moist crumbs).
Step 5
Then, while the brownies cool, prepare the frosting by melting butter, adding cocoa powder and milk, then whisking in powdered sugar and vanilla. Drizzle the luscious frosting over the cooled brownies, ensuring it covers the entire surface in a smooth, even layer.
